Special Admissions

special-admissions.jpgAll persons interested in completing a program of study at the Seminary are encouraged to apply. Special consideration will be given to applicants who do not meet the general academic requirements listed above. They may be granted provisional status. Provisional status permits students to enrol in a limited number of courses while correcting admissions deficiencies. It also provides an opportunity for students to demonstrate adequate academic achievement to warrant continued enrolment in a program.

Students granted provisional admission will be permitted to complete up to twelve (12) credit hours of courses. Upon completion of those courses, students achieving a ‘C' average (or better) with no ‘F's' will be considered for admission to the Biblical Studies Certificate program. Students desiring entrance into the Pastoral Ministries Diploma program must have passed at least three (3) ‘O' level exams and have achieved a ‘B' average (or better) with no ‘F's' in the Biblical Studies Certificate program. Prior to enrolling in courses offered by Piedmont Baptist College, students must meet all standard admissions requirements.
